how easy are they to fit?
Title: Re: Dark red hazard switch (p/n 18G 953 509)
Post by: Scottymon on October 08, 2013, 03:20:24 pm
Easy mate.
If you haven't already, grab some plastic tools (Bojo ones are decent) then pull the top section above the HU off, may require you to unclip a cable, then remove the old switch and replace with the new one... reverse order job done... probably 5 mins.
